Chuli Para - Kushalgarh, Banswara

Chuli Para is a village situated in the Kushalgarh tehsil of Banswara district, Rajasthan. It is located approximately 13 km from the tehsil headquarters in Kushalgarh and around 58 km from the district headquarters in Banswara. Ukala serves as the Gram Panchayat for Chuli Para village.

As per Census 2011, the village code of Chuli Para is 099790. The village covers a total geographical area of 278 hectares and falls under the 327801 pincode. Kushalgarh is the nearest town, located about 13 km away.

Chuli Para village is governed under the Panchayati Raj system, with a Sarpanch serving as the elected head.

Population of Chuli Para

As per Census 2011, Chuli Para village has a total population of 851 people, consisting of 426 males and 425 females. The village has 169 households and a sex ratio of 997 females per 1,000 males. There are 184 children in the 0–6 years age group. The village has 229 literate and 622 illiterate residents. Additionally, 831 people belong to Scheduled Tribe (ST) communities.

Transport and Connectivity of Chuli Para

Public transport in the Chuli Para is mainly available through shared auto-rickshaws. The nearest railway station is Thandla Rd, while the nearest airport is Vadodara Airport, situated at an approximate aerial distance of 120.4 km.
